Children of the Revolution

Liberation

2004-04-21

Liberation is the fourth release for Seattle-based Children of the Revolution. It's a truly eclectic album - blending flamenco, Latin, Greek, Eastern, rock, jazz, etc. Nearly a dozen multi-talented musicians make up the core group, allowing for complex musical and vocal arrangements and plenty of variety in styles. The album is full of passionate, energetic, inspiring songs - a joy to listen to.
